Not all Nov 2006 have a buzzing, my last one did not at all. I returned it because of some minor light bleed in the corners. I now have a Dec 2006 that has NO back light bleed and again, no buzzing.

If you have the chance, get a December model. There are stickers on the box that can be of some help to identify. You will have better odds of having back light bleed and buzzing if you get a November however, but that is not 100%. If you do, just take it back.
